"People I hit, they seem to get hurt," said the popular McCrory afterwards. "Three fights and all three have hit the floor, although I've never knocked somebody out cold like that!

"I got carried away in the first round, looking for the shots. He caught me with one or two, he was game to fight, but I knew once I caught him clean that I was going to knock him out."

McCrory now has two KO victories in his last two fights, bringing him to 3-0 in a career that has certainly got off to a blistering start. In contrast, Bique falls to a dismal 0-3 record - including two early stoppage defeats.
